3. Information about cookies.

The website uses cookies.
Cookie files (so-called “cookies”) are IT data, in particular text files, which are stored on the Website User’s end device and are intended for using the Website’s pages. Cookies usually contain the name of the website from which they originate, their storage time on the end device and a unique number.
The entity placing cookies on the Website User’s end device and accessing them is the Website operator.

Cookies are used for the following purposes:

◦ create statistics that help understand how Website Users use websites, which allows improving their structure and content;
◦ maintaining the Website User’s session (after logging in), thanks to which the User does not have to re-enter the login and password on each subpage of the Website;
◦ determining the user’s profile in order to display him tailored materials in advertising networks, in particular the Google network.

The Website uses two basic types of cookies: “session” cookies and “persistent” cookies. Session cookies are temporary files that are stored on the User’s end device until logging out, leaving the website or turning off the software (web browser). Persistent cookies are stored on the User’s end device for the time specified in the cookie parameters or until they are deleted by the User.
Software for browsing websites (web browser) usually by default allows storing cookies on the User’s end device. Website Users can change the settings in this regard. The web browser allows you to delete cookies. It is also possible to automatically block cookies. Detailed information on this subject is provided in the help or documentation of the web browser.
Restrictions on the use of cookies may affect some of the functionalities available on the Website.
